Add 63/60 and 10/16
1st number: 1 3/60, 2nd number: 10/16
63/60 + 10/16 is 67/40.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 60 and 16 is 240
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 240 - For the 1st fraction, since 60 × 4 = 240,
63/60 = 63 × 4/60 × 4 = 252/240 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 16 × 15 = 240,
10/16 = 10 × 15/16 × 15 = 150/240 - Add the two like fractions:
252/240 + 150/240 = 252 + 150/240 = 402/240 - 402/240 simplified gives 67/40
- So, 63/60 + 10/16 = 67/40
